Frequently Asked Questions

What CAN FD data rate does TCAN1044AVDRQ1 support, and which automotive networks does this enable?

TCAN1044AVDRQ1 supports CAN FD data rates up to 8 Mbps in the data phase, enabling high-bandwidth automotive networks such as CAN FD backbones in ADAS sensor fusion units, electric vehicle battery management systems, and powertrain ECUs where the legacy 1 Mbps CAN limit is insufficient for the volume of data exchanged.

What automotive qualification level does TCAN1044AVDRQ1 carry and why does it matter for ECU design?

TCAN1044AVDRQ1 is qualified to AEC-Q100 Grade 1, meaning it is tested and certified to operate reliably in automotive environments covering the junction temperature range of -40°C to 125°C, the electrical stress conditions of 12 V vehicle bus transients, and the long service life expected of automotive-grade semiconductors in production vehicles.

How does the single-channel 8-pin SOIC package of TCAN1044AVDRQ1 simplify ECU PCB design?

The 8-pin SOIC package of TCAN1044AVDRQ1 provides a minimal 4.9 mm x 3.9 mm footprint that allows the CAN FD transceiver to be placed close to the MCU CAN peripheral, shortening high-speed signal traces. A single-channel design avoids routing of unused channels, reducing layout complexity in cost-sensitive body control or gateway node designs.

How does TCAN1044AVDRQ1 compare to a standard CAN transceiver for a new automotive CAN FD node design?

Compared to a classical CAN transceiver limited to 1 Mbps, TCAN1044AVDRQ1 supports CAN FD at up to 8 Mbps while maintaining backward compatibility with the standard CAN protocol, allowing a system designer to future-proof an ECU node for higher-bandwidth software-over-the-air update payloads without changing the physical layer connector or wiring harness.

About Texas Instruments

Texas Instruments (TI) is a global semiconductor company headquartered in Dallas, Texas. TI designs and manufactures analog and embedded processing chips used in industrial, automotive, consumer, communications, and enterprise systems.
